Output 7ba59b21419b877c5364875c794f814d8c55946c858428aebb6b96dc4b91e078:1

value
358785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10e58841b70e51a2c45d2336f804c98d37fbc2c7 OP_EQUAL
address
33EMhnykvxCZAsnBh9a4PV7RuvGKTgxgQ2
transaction
7ba59b21419b877c5364875c794f814d8c55946c858428aebb6b96dc4b91e078
spent
true